Chairwoman of the Council of the Republic Natalya Kochanova held a working meeting with medical workers on 26 January, BelTA learned from the press service of the upper house of the Belarusian parliament.

It was a regular videoconference to discuss ways to counter the spread of coronavirus infection and brought together representatives of the Healthcare Ministry and healthcare institutions of Minsk.

Characterizing the current epidemiological situation, the experts noted a slight uptake in the incidence of acute respiratory diseases and COVID-19. The parties analyzed the measures taken and in the pipeline to treat and prevent the spread of coronavirus infection. Special attention was paid to the issues of rapid tests at home and the tactics of treatment of asymptomatic patients.

In general, the situation is manageable and is under control, the experts said.
